MergePullsubscription

10/11/2009 - 14:52 von Rolf | Report spam
Hallo NG,

ich möchte eine SQL-Server Replikation aus einem dotnet.vb Programm
heraus aufrufen.
Die notwendigen Klassen hierzu befinden sich in der Imports
Microsoft.SqlServer.Replication.dll. Diese habe ich eingebunden
erhalte jedoch die Fehlermeldung, Der Typ "MergePullSubscription" ist
nicht definiert

Der genaue Code (aufs wesentliche reduziert) lautet:

Imports Microsoft.SqlServer.Replication

Public Class WebSynchronisation

' Member Variablen
Dim subscription As MergePullSubscription
Dim agent As MergeSynchronizationAgent

End Class

Mit der Klasse MergeSynchronizationAgent gibt es keine Probleme. Diese
befindet sich laut Microsoft Dokumentation im selben Namespace.

Bin für jeden Hinweis dankbar.
Rolf
 

Lesen sie die antworten

#1 Elmar Boye
10/11/2009 - 17:33 | Warnen spam
Hallo Rolf,

"Rolf" schrieb ...
ich möchte eine SQL-Server Replikation aus einem dotnet.vb Programm
heraus aufrufen.
Die notwendigen Klassen hierzu befinden sich in der Imports
Microsoft.SqlServer.Replication.dll. Diese habe ich eingebunden
erhalte jedoch die Fehlermeldung, Der Typ "MergePullSubscription" ist
nicht definiert



laut Dokumentation findet sich die Klasse in
"Microsoft.Sqlserver.RMO.dll"
http://msdn.microsoft.com/de-de/lib...ption.aspx

Zusammenhànge beschreibt:
http://msdn.microsoft.com/de-de/lib...46869.aspx
"Replikationsverwaltungsobjekte (RMO)"

Der genaue Code (aufs wesentliche reduziert) lautet:



Beispiele findest Du u.a. unter RMO-Programmierung in:
http://msdn.microsoft.com/de-de/lib...52503.aspx
"Erstellen, Ändern und Löschen von Abonnements (Replikation)"

Gruß Elmar

Ähnliche fragen